Output e04b52cebfa30b2c86fc26d431f23c8e794f675b3d3e655969db93d2f97ad827:4

value
7706234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d76e48b891a65a39e31b6dff84d6d41b7f9035 OP_EQUAL
address
3PZBVnWR2E3mHTZP93QRSZVEGqJVwC5QrS
transaction
e04b52cebfa30b2c86fc26d431f23c8e794f675b3d3e655969db93d2f97ad827
spent
true